COLLEGE BASEBALL CONFERENCE TOURNAMENT RESULTS FROM APRIL 30th

* SOUTHERN STATES ATHLETIC CONFERENCE *

PrintUPSET OF THE DAY – The SSAC’s 8th seeded AUBURN UNIVERSITY AT MONTGOMERY WARHAWKS (formerly the Senators) delivered the shock of the day yesterday. The Warhawks rose up and dragged down the conference’s top seeded FAULKNER UNIVERSITY EAGLES in an undeniable Instant Classic. The Eagles were leading 2-0 going into the top of the 8th Inning when the Warhawk bats came to life, seizing a 4-2 lead. Faulkner, the defending national champions of NAIA college baseball, pulled to 4-3 in their half of the Inning and AUM responded by adding another run in the top of the 9th. The Warhawks limited the Eagles to just 1 run themselves in the bottom of the Inning and nabbed a 5-4 victory! AUM’s P.J. Leto got the win!  

brewtonparkerTHEY HAD ‘EM ALL THE WAY! – With apologies to the late baseball broadcaster Bob Prince. The 2nd seeded BREWTON- PARKER COLLEGE BARONS well and truly had their First Round opponents – the 7th seeded UNIVERSITY OF MOBILE RAMS – all the way. A 2-0 lead after the 1st Inning became 3-0 after the 2nd, 4-0 after the 5th and 6-0 after the 6th! The Rams finally got on the board in the top of the 8th Inning with a pair of runs but the Barons added another run of their own to make it 7-2, which would hold up as the final score! COLLEGE BASEBALL POSTSEASON ACTION CONTINUES

El Camino College logoSO-CAL DIVISION: PLAY-IN ROUND – GAME ONE – The game of the day yesterday was this classic of the diamond played between the 17th seeded EL CAMINO COLLEGE WARRIORS and the 16th seeded MOUNT SAN ANTONIO COLLEGE MOUNTIES. After two scoreless Innings the Warriors put up a run in the top of the 3rd with the Mounties eventually tying things up in the bottom of the 6th. El Camino College responded with another run of their own in the top of the 7th Inning and rode that ball to a 2-1 victory. Credit Andrew Burschinger with the win.  

66_eastlosangeleslogo.GIF (120×160) SO-CAL DIVISION: PLAY-IN ROUND – GAME TWO – This game pitted the 15th seeded EAST LOS ANGELES COLLEGE HUSKIES against the 18 seeds – the COLLEGE OF THE CANYONS COUGARS. The Cougars took a 2-0 lead in the top of the 2nd Inning but by the bottom of the 3rd the Huskies had tied the game up. In the 5th and 7th Innings College of the Canyons logged a pair of runs to make it a 4-2 Cougar advantage. In the bottom of the 7th East Los Angeles College again knotted up the game. After the Cougars went on top again 5-4 in the top of the 8th the Huskies used their half of the Inning to take their first lead of the game at 6-5, which turned out to be the final score, too. COLLEGE BASEBALL: NAIA CONFERENCE TOURNAMENTS DAY TWO

Point Park U PioneersThe Kentucky Intercollegiate Athletic Conference’s 2014 tourney entered Day Two yesterday. The top seeded POINT PARK UNIVERSITY PIONEERS joined the fun and took the diamond against the 4th seeded BEREA COLLEGE MOUNTAINEERS. The two teams were tied up at 1-1 after the 1st Inning and remained in that state of affairs until the Pioneers took a 2-1 lead in the 4th. A big 5th inning for Point Park saw them notch 3 additional runs and with another run in the 8th for them plus a Berea run in the 7th the final score was Pioneers 6  Mountaineers 2.
